Frequently Asked Questions about London

How much are Studio apartments in London?

There are currently 138 Studio Apartments in London with rent ranges from $1,049 to $1,695 with an average price of $1,344.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om London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in London ranges from $650 to $2,870 with an average monthly rent of $1,664.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in London c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in London range from $1,225 to $7,200.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,108.

How expensive are London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 132 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in London on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,525 to $7,300 - averaging $2,698 for the location.
